提取EXE文件图标成ICO格式工具介绍

需积分: 25 6 下载量 2 浏览量 更新于2025-01-08 收藏 2KB RAR 举报
资源摘要信息:"取EXE程序图标ICO.rar" 该压缩包文件标题为"取EXE程序图标ICO.rar",表明该文件包可能包含了用于从EXE程序中提取图标的工具或代码示例。描述和标签与标题相同,均表明了压缩包的用途。虽然未提供压缩包内具体文件的详细信息,但根据标题可以推测出其包含的相关知识点。 1. EXE文件格式:EXE是Windows操作系统下的可执行文件扩展名,用于封装程序代码、资源等。每个EXE文件都可能包含一个图标,用于在文件资源管理器中或程序启动时代表该程序。 2. ICO文件格式:ICO是一种图像文件格式,用于存放Windows图标(.ico文件),这种图标是多尺寸的,可以在不同的显示分辨率和环境下使用,比如桌面、开始菜单、任务栏等。 3. 图标提取工具的原理:一般而言,图标提取工具会扫描EXE文件的资源部分,寻找图标资源并将其提取出来。这通常需要对Windows资源文件格式(如PE格式)有所了解。 4. PE文件格式:PE(Portable Executable)是Windows操作系统中用于封装可执行文件(EXE、DLL等)的一种文件格式。它包含了许多关于程序的信息,例如程序入口点、文件资源等。工具可能利用对PE格式的解析来定位和提取图标。 5. 提取图标的工具或代码:该压缩包可能包含命令行工具、图形界面程序,或者编程语言(如C/C++、Python等)编写的脚本,用于自动化提取图标的过程。使用这些工具或代码可以大大简化提取图标的操作。 6. 图标提取的实际应用:提取EXE程序图标有多种实际应用,例如反编译者可能需要查看程序图标以快速识别软件,或者软件开发者可能希望利用已有的程序图标作为参考或者用于新的软件开发。 7. 相关软件开发知识:提取图标的操作可能涉及到软件开发的知识,尤其是资源编辑器的使用,这类工具允许开发者查看、修改和提取PE文件中的资源,包括图标。 8. 法律和版权问题:在提取和使用他人的程序图标时,需要注意版权问题,确保图标使用不侵犯原作者的版权。 9. 程序图标的设计:图标作为一种视觉元素,其设计往往遵循一定的图形设计原则,比如简洁性、可识别性和易读性,以及考虑图标在不同背景和尺寸下的表现。 10. 图标文件的编辑与转换:提取出的图标文件可能需要根据需求进行编辑或转换格式,以便于在不同的环境和应用中使用。 总结以上信息,压缩包"取EXE程序图标ICO.rar"可能包含工具或代码,用于从EXE文件中提取图标资源,涉及到文件格式解析、软件开发、版权法规等多个方面的知识。